The LOCAL function key
This key is used for returning the Power Supply to LOCAL control (enabling
programming and set-up of its parameters from the front panel) after a remote device
has been controlling it.
During manual calibration, the LOCAL key is used for aborting the calibration
process.
The RESET function key
The RESET key is used for resetting faults and error indications:

The SYSTEM function key
The SYSTEM key is mainly a navigation aid and has the functions summarized in
the following table:

The OUT function key
The OUT function key controls the state of the Power Modules output:
